The Best Plants for Beginners

For new gardeners, selecting plants that suit your lifestyle and environment is crucial. Opt for hardy species that can tolerate a little neglect but reward your initial efforts with delightful results. Here’s a curated list of the best plants for beginners that offer beauty and minimal fuss.

1. Spider Plant (Chlorophytum comosum)

Spider plants are resilient and adaptable, making them perfect for beginners. They thrive in bright, indirect light but can also endure lower lighting conditions. With their arching leaves and ability to produce “pups” or baby plants, spider plants add a touch of greenery and are fun to propagate.

2. Pothos (Epipremnum aureum)

Pothos, also known as devil’s ivy, is renowned for its tolerance to low light and irregular watering. Its heart-shaped leaves create a lush, leafy display that can trail beautifully. Perfect for those who might occasionally forget to water, pothos purifies the air and grows quickly under the right conditions.

3. Peace Lily (Spathiphyllum)

Peace lilies are not only aesthetically pleasing with their shiny leaves and white blooms, but they are also excellent air purifiers. They prefer shaded areas, making them ideal for indoor spaces. Peace lilies communicate their watering needs by wilting, making care easy to gauge.

4. Succulents

Succulents are a diverse group of plants that store water in their leaves, allowing them to withstand dry conditions. Available in various shapes and sizes, they are low-maintenance and only need watering every few weeks. With succulents, it’s easy to create a captivating desert vibe in your home.

5. Basil (Ocimum basilicum)

Growing your own herbs can be incredibly rewarding. Basil is one of the best plants for beginners wanting to start a culinary garden. With its aromatic leaves, it thrives in sunny spots and regular watering. Plucking fresh basil to enhance your dishes is immensely satisfying.

6. Snake Plant (Sansevieria trifasciata)

Also known as mother-in-law’s tongue, snake plants are virtually indestructible. They can survive low light and infrequent watering, making them ideal for forgetful caregivers. They also release oxygen at night, making them a top choice for bedroom décor.

7. Lavender (Lavandula)

Lavender, with its calming scent and beautiful purple flowers, can thrive both in the garden and in pots. Preferring full sun and well-drained soil, lavender is drought-resistant once established and adds a touch of elegance and fragrance to any space.

8. Mint (Mentha)

If you’re keen on adding fresh flavor to your tea or dishes, mint is an excellent choice. It grows quickly and can become invasive, so it’s best kept in a pot. Mint enjoys a sunny location and regular watering, making it easy for beginners to manage.

9. ZZ Plant (Zamioculcas zamiifolia)

The ZZ plant is known for its glossy leaves and low-maintenance requirements. It can tolerate low light and infrequent watering, thriving on neglect. This plant is ideal for desk plants or darker corners of your home.

10. Ferns

Ferns, with their delicate fronds and lush greenery, are perfect for shaded or humid areas. They require regular watering and misting but offer a lush look that’s rewarding to cultivate. Ferns come in many varieties, each bringing its own charm to your garden space.

What are the best plants for beginners?

The best plants for beginners include species like spider plants, pothos, succulents, and peace lilies due to their adaptability and low-maintenance nature.

How often should I water my indoor plants?

Watering frequency depends on the plant type, light exposure, and climate. A general guideline is to water once the top inch of soil feels dry.

Can I grow herbs indoors?

Yes, many herbs such as basil and mint can be grown indoors with sufficient sunlight and regular care.

Where should I place my succulents?

Succulents do best in bright, indirect sunlight. A windowsill that receives plenty of natural light is ideal.

What should I do if my plant starts wilting?

Check if the plant needs watering or if it’s been overwatered. Adjust care accordingly, and remember some plants may wilt when thirsty, signaling a need for water.
